Rockies reach 1-year deals with Belisle, Flores




ENLARGE
DENVER (AP) - The Colorado Rockies say they've agreed to terms on one-year deals with pitchers Matt Belisle and Randy Flores.

The club announced the deals on Thursday but didn't release the financial terms.

The Rockies also said that right-handed pitcher Joel Peralta and infielder Omar Quintanilla were outrighted off the 40-man roster, with Peralta deciding to become a free agent.

Belisle, a right-hander, made 24 appearances with the Rockies this season, going 3-1 with a 5.52 ERA.

Flores, a reliever, went 0-1 in 27 games and had a 5.25 ERA.
